WebAs an example, filler alloy 4643 was developed for welding 6xxx series base alloys and developing high mechanical properties in post-weld heat-treated conditions. This alloy was developed by taking the well-known alloy 4043, reducing the silicon, and adding 0.10 to 0.30 percent magnesium, this ensured its ability to unquestionably respond to ... WebDec 4, 2014 · To answer your question, most welds in 6061-T6, whether made with 4043 or 4643, are heat-treatable to a degree. This happens because enough 6061-T6 is melted in the weld so that magnesium from it is added to the filler and makes it essentially an Al-Si-Mg alloy, which is heat-treatable. WebDescription: Alloy 4643 is designed for welding aluminum alloys 3003 and 6061. This alloy gives higher tensile strength in thick weldments on 6xxx alloys after postweld solution heat treatment and aging.
